4.7 Connecting the remote
CAUTION!
Risk of unintended stops
If the plug of the remote cable is broken, the
remote cable may come loose while driving. The
remote could suddenly switch off when losing
power. This forces an unintended stop.
– Always check the plug of the remote for
damage. Contact your provider immediately in
case of a damaged plug.
Risk of damage to the remote
The remote plug and connector socket fit
together in one way only.
– Do not force them together.
1. Lightly push to connect the plug of the remote cable
and the connector socket. The plug must lock in place
with an audible click.
